| Birth: | Aug. 19, 1823 | | Death: | Nov. 3, 1886 |  Served in the U.S. Army during the Mexican War, was a U.S. Representative from Illinois 1859-1865 & 1871-1875 (7th District 1859-1863, 11th District 1863-1865, 8th District 1871-1873, 12th District 1873-1875), candidate for Governor of Illinois 1864.
